Testing of the point accuracy of measurements by the RTK method at different distances of the reference station for monitoring of the dynamic effect in a subsidence basin [PDF]
In the area of Technical University in Ostrava were stabilized 35 points for testing of the accuracy of RTK measurement. All points of the testing base line were located by a new digital leveling instrument Leica DNA 03 with a precise leveling line.
